Range of Therapy



Emergency dentistry concentrates on dealing with urgent oral problems such as serious toothaches or injuries that call for instant interest. When you experience unexpected and extreme pain, swelling, bleeding, or trauma to your teeth or periodontals, looking for immediate care from an emergency situation dental professional is crucial. These specialized oral professionals are furnished to manage severe situations that can not wait on a regular visit.

Whether it's a knocked-out tooth, a fractured tooth, or excruciating discomfort, emergency situation dentistry supplies timely relief and required treatment to relieve your pain.

In emergency dentistry, the main objective is to maintain your problem, manage your pain, and stop additional damage to your dental health. Action Time



For immediate dental concerns, timely response time plays a critical function in minimizing discomfort and avoiding further issues. When dealing with a dental emergency, such as extreme toothaches, knocked-out teeth, or sudden swelling, time is essential. Looking for prompt treatment from an emergency situation dental professional can make a considerable distinction in the result of your scenario. Delays in treatment can not only lengthen your pain yet also boost the threat of infection or permanent damage to your teeth and periodontals.

On the other hand, routine dentistry visits are typically set up beforehand for routine exams, cleansings, or non-urgent procedures. While these consultations are essential for keeping oral health and wellness, they're generally not meant to resolve immediate issues that require instant attention. Regular dentistry concentrates on preventive treatment and lasting treatment planning rather than instant treatments for severe issues.



Therefore, when faced with a sudden oral problem that can not wait, it's vital to focus on fast activity and seek aid from an emergency dental professional to attend to the issue promptly and successfully.

Cost and Insurance coverage



Taking into consideration the financial aspect of dental treatment, comprehending the distinctions in expense and insurance policy coverage in between emergency situation dental care and regular dental care is crucial. Emergency dental care typically comes with a higher cost compared to routine oral solutions. Since emergencies typically require prompt attention, the expenses might consist of after-hours costs or expedited services, which can contribute to the general expense.

In contrast, regular dental care generally includes planned visits for preventative care, regular examinations, and common procedures like cleansings and fillings, which are usually much more affordable.

When it involves insurance coverage, emergency dental solutions might in some cases have limited choices approved by service providers, resulting in possible out-of-pocket expenditures for individuals. On the other hand, normal dental care is typically a lot more straightened with common insurance policy plans, making it less complicated for people to use their insurance coverage and reduce personal expenses.
